Khana Khazana, SIA style!

Sanajay Kapoor of Khana Khazana fame joins Singapore Airlines culinary panel

BY A CORRESPONDENT
April 12, 2006

Singapore Airlines International has announced a nine-member culinary panel that includes award-winning Khana Khazana host, Sanjeev Kapoor. He is the only Indian in the panel that includes three US chefs, and one chef each from France, Australia, Japan, UK and Hong Kong.

Senior vice-president Yap Kim Wah was full of praise for the Khan khazana expert, saying, "His creativity and innovation with Indian cuisine will be a welcome addition to the global cuisines and add to the variety of menus offered onboard."

A popular TV host, Sanjay Kapoor has several culinary achievements to his credit. His cookery show 'Khana Khazana' has been running for 13 years and has won the 'Best Cookery Show' award several times. He has also been restaurant consultant at several prestigious establishments including the Al Nasr Leisureland in Dubai, the Grain of Salt at Kolkata and the countrywide chain of restaurants, The Yellow Chilli.

In addition, he has produced a range of successful products including Pickles, Blended Masalas, Sprinklers and 123 Ready To Cook Mixes. His books on Indian Recipes have also received rare reviews and shown his versatility and range with food products. Not only has he been a presence at International Culinary Festivals, he has also recently received the 'Award for Brand Excellence.'
